Age Restrictions – 18+ Only
Gambling on pinnacle-au.com is strictly for users aged 18 and over. We conduct identity and age verification checks in line with Australian gambling legislation. Self-Control Tools Available to Players
We provide a range of tools that allow you to manage your gambling activity. These can be activated at any time from your account settings or by contacting support:
- Deposit limits – set daily, weekly, or monthly maximums
- Session time reminders – receive alerts after a defined period of play
- Reality checks – on-screen prompts displaying your session duration
- Loss limits – cap the total amount you can lose within a set period
- Cool-off periods – take a short break of 24 hours to 6 weeks
Deposit Limits
Setting a deposit limit is one of the most effective ways to manage your gambling budget. Once set, limits take effect immediately when reduced and require a waiting period of at least 24 hours before an increase can be applied. This delay is intentional — it gives you time to reconsider.
Self-Exclusion
If you feel you need a more significant break from gambling, self-exclusion allows you to close your account for a defined or indefinite period. During self-exclusion, you will not be able to log in or place bets, and we will suspend all marketing communications to you. To initiate self-exclusion, contact our support team directly. You can also register with the national self-exclusion register, BetStop, which covers all licensed Australian operators.
Warning Signs of Problem Gambling
Recognising harmful patterns early can make a significant difference. Common warning signs include:
- Spending more time or money on gambling than intended
- Gambling to recover previous losses
- Neglecting work, family, or personal responsibilities
- Feeling anxious, irritable, or restless when not gambling
- Borrowing money or selling possessions to fund gambling
If any of these resonate with you, please reach out to a support service or use our self-exclusion tools.
Australian Support Resources
You are not alone. Several free and confidential services are available across Australia:
| Organisation | Contact | Service Type |
|---|---|---|
| Gambling Help Online | 1800 858 858 | 24/7 phone & online chat |
| Lifeline Australia | 13 11 14 | Crisis support, 24/7 |
| BetStop | betsto p.gov.au | National self-exclusion register |
| MoneySmart | moneysmart.gov.au | Financial counselling |
